Output 3375eb83d736bf32577181b3a1bb60724c40959c2313844721bd372b54b9e6fb:0

value
129942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 269b0fe548a03fa2400ed1ac3a2c6ff5460aa463 OP_EQUAL
address
35D9MjfPH26JKAguh1povLnfRtMSncjek6
transaction
3375eb83d736bf32577181b3a1bb60724c40959c2313844721bd372b54b9e6fb
confirmations
53626
spent
true